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Gatwick Airport to Nafferton start from as little as £49.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Gatwick Airport to Nafferton start from £84.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Gatwick Airport to Nafferton are available for £175.20 one way

Facilities and Amenities at Gatwick Airport Station

Though there is no ticket office, purchasing and collecting train tickets at Gatwick Airport Station is made easy with accessible ticket machines available throughout the premises. These machines are ideal for collecting tickets bought online, ensuring you’re all set to board your train without hassle.

The station is well-equipped for travelers with accessibility needs, with step-free access available across all platforms. For those requiring additional assistance, staff at Gatwick are available to offer help as needed. You’ll also find heated waiting areas on the platforms to ensure comfort during cooler months.

Additional amenities include accessible toilets and baby changing facilities, available on both the platforms and in the airport terminal itself. For those seeking refreshment or needing to withdraw cash, you’ll find facilities readily available, including a variety of shops and dining options in the adjacent airport terminal.

Onward Travel Options

There are numerous onward travel options available directly from the station. For direct connectivity, taxis can be found at the South Terminal bus station, a short walk from the concourse. There are also various car hire providers operating from the airport terminals, perfect for those looking to explore at their own pace.

Bus connections are conveniently located at the upper level of the bus station, providing easy access to further travel by road. Gatwick Airport is known for its close ties to the south east rail network, making the transition from air travel to city commuting remarkably straightforward.

Facilities and Amenities at Nafferton Station

While Nafferton Station may not boast a grandiose list of amenities, it provides the key essentials for a comfortable journey. Even though there is no ticket office, travelers can easily collect tickets using the available ticket machines, which is perfect for those who've booked online. However, it’s important to note that the machines are not accessible for all, as there are no accessible ticket machines.

If you’re in need of assistance, there are no on-site staff available, but help points are installed for customer support. Additionally, audio announcements and departure screens keep you up-to-date with the latest travel information. As for accessibility, the station provides step-free entry to certain areas, supported by ramps where necessary, ensuring ease of travel for those with mobility aids. It's worth exploring the station's 360 map online for a virtual tour to familiarize yourself before visiting.

Travel Connections

Nafferton is a perfect hub for further exploring the surrounding region. Although taxis aren’t immediately available outside the station, travelers can utilize the Northern Railway’s Cab4You service to organize a ride. Rail replacement services are convenient from the Driffield Rd bus stop, adjacent to the Cross Keys pub, during disruptions. Although there are no direct buses nearby, many opportunities for travel across Yorkshire are just a short journey away.
